客户简介
2017年,逸仙电商推出首个彩妆品牌完美日记(Perfect Diary)。2019年,逸仙电商开始全面推进新零售业务,依托线上销售经验及数据支撑,联动线上线下打造*无拘束的美妆体验店。
业务挑战
由于业务量爆发,完美日记的业务系统在数据库方面遇到了以下问题:
- 库存不统一,每个渠道有独立的库存,每次大促都导致库存超卖;
- 数据库的吞吐难以提升,导致大促时需要在应用侧把流控限制在只有几百TPS;
- 每次大促前后,MySQL升降配的时间都很长。如果压测时容量评估不足,临时对MySQL升配基本解决不了问题;
- 大促时需要实时了解运营数据,但是使用MySQL跑统计分析的SQL性能很差。使用Hadoop做大数据分析涉及的组件很多,Hadoop集群的运维很麻烦;
- 应用发新版本时,部分SQL没有经过调优,随着业务数据增多,有些SQL会运行越来越慢,影响用户体验;
- 研发、测试、运维、运营人员都可以直接登录数据库执行各种SQL,对数据安全和数据库的稳定性都有很大的隐患。
解决方案
PolarDB + DTS + ADB 组成HTAP解决方案简单高效地满足了完美日记运营人员对数据在线化的需求,8组C8 ECU跑统计分析类SQL即可达到100 QPS以上,全链路从写入到查询响应时间基本是秒级。
完美日记在2020年Q1借助阿里云DBS服务快速实现了异地备份,以满足安全等保三级的要求。并且完美日记也成为数据库自治服务DAS商用后的第一批用户,体验到了数据库自感知、自修复、自优化、自运维及自安全等强大和便捷的功能。完美日记目前正在实施分布式数据库改造,改造完成后,电商系统将可以实现线性的性能扩展。
客户价值
完美日记利用阿里云数据库PaaS服务快速解决了很多业界常见的痛点,给所有的独角兽企业树立了一个利用数字基础设施助力业务快速增长的标杆。
- 通过SQL洞察和CloudDBA等工具,对每一个实例进行调优,全面梳理每一个数据库的系统资源使用率和系统瓶颈。找到慢查询,热点数据等隐患,提前排除性能有隐患的逻辑。力保双十一活动稳定顺利进行。
- 每秒成交的订单数再创历史新高,订单峰值比历史最高峰值再次提高了几倍,高峰业务流量比半年前提高了50倍,系统丝般顺滑!
- 2020年4月,完美日记3周年大促最后一天压测,订单系统下单速度摸高到1万笔/每秒,对应PolarDB数据库的写入速度10万TPS,比半年前的系统吞吐提升了50倍!